PTFE slide bearings are composed of a layer of PTFE material bonded to a metal backing plate, typically made of stainless steel This unique composition allows for smooth, low-friction movement between surfaces, making them an excellent choice for applications where sliding motion is required The PTFE material is well-known for its self-lubricating properties, which reduce friction and wear on the bearing surfaces, resulting in longer service life and reduced maintenance requirements.
One of the key benefits of PTFE slide bearings is their ability to accommodate lateral movement and thermal expansion in structures and machinery This flexibility is crucial in applications where temperature variations or movement due to wind, seismic activity, or other factors can cause stress on the bearing points PTFE slide bearings can easily accommodate these movements without compromising the integrity of the structure, making them a reliable choice for critical applications where precision and stability are essential.
Another advantage of PTFE slide bearings is their resistance to corrosion and chemical exposure The PTFE material is highly resistant to most chemicals, solvents, and corrosive substances, making it a durable and long-lasting option for harsh environments This resistance to chemical degradation ensures that PTFE slide bearings maintain their performance and structural integrity even in challenging conditions, making them suitable for use in a wide range of industries, including chemical processing, wastewater treatment, and marine applications.

PTFE slide bearings are also known for their low coefficient of friction, which allows for smooth and effortless movement between surfaces This low friction helps to reduce the amount of force required to initiate sliding motion, resulting in energy savings and reduced wear on the bearing surfaces In high-load applications, such as heavy machinery or structural supports, this low-friction characteristic of PTFE slide bearings can help to improve overall efficiency and performance, leading to cost savings and extended service life.
